引言
随着人工智能技术的飞速发展,大模型训练已成为推动智能产品创新的重要手段。本文将深入探讨大模型训练的原理、过程及其在智能产品中的应用,揭示打造智能产品背后的软件奥秘。
一、大模型训练概述
1.1 什么是大模型
大模型是指参数量达到亿级别甚至更高的神经网络模型。这类模型具有强大的特征提取和表达能力,能够处理复杂的数据和任务。
1.2 大模型训练的目的
大模型训练旨在通过大量数据对模型进行优化,使其在特定任务上达到最佳性能。
二、大模型训练原理
2.1 神经网络
大模型训练的核心是神经网络。神经网络是一种模拟人脑神经元连接的计算机模型,通过多层非线性变换实现特征提取和分类。
2.2 损失函数
损失函数用于衡量模型预测值与真实值之间的差距,是优化模型参数的关键。
2.3 优化算法
优化算法用于调整模型参数,使损失函数值最小化。常见的优化算法有梯度下降、Adam等。
三、大模型训练过程
3.1 数据收集与预处理
数据收集是训练大模型的基础。预处理包括数据清洗、归一化、特征提取等步骤。
3.2 模型设计
根据任务需求设计合适的神经网络结构,包括层数、神经元数量、激活函数等。
3.3 模型训练
将预处理后的数据输入模型,通过优化算法调整参数,使模型在训练集上达到最佳性能。
3.4 模型评估
在测试集上评估模型性能,确保模型泛化能力。
3.5 模型部署
将训练好的模型部署到实际应用场景中,实现智能产品的功能。
四、大模型在智能产品中的应用
4.1 自然语言处理
大模型在自然语言处理领域取得了显著成果,如机器翻译、文本摘要、情感分析等。
4.2 计算机视觉
大模型在计算机视觉领域表现出色,如图像识别、目标检测、视频分析等。
4.3 语音识别
大模型在语音识别领域取得了突破性进展,如语音合成、语音识别、语音搜索等。
五、总结
大模型训练是打造智能产品的重要手段。通过深入了解大模型训练的原理、过程及其在智能产品中的应用,我们可以更好地把握这一技术发展趋势,为我国人工智能产业发展贡献力量。
